Our Wet Grinding and Wet Polishing Process
Coast To Coast Terrazzo Restoration uses a wet grind and wet polish technique that gently but effectively rejuvenates terrazzo. Working wet helps control dust, keeps the floor cooler during refinement, and allows the surface to be restored with a smooth, consistent finish.
The grinding stage begins with Metal Dot Diamond Infused Pads. We step through 30, 60, and 120 grit to remove the worn surface layer and address surface imperfections. This stage is important because it exposes fresh terrazzo, levels minor unevenness, and prepares the floor for a true mechanical polish.
After grinding, we polish the floor using Diamond Infused Resins from 50 grit up to 3000 grit. Each step refines the surface further, increasing clarity, smoothness, and reflectivity. The final result is a deep, natural shine that comes from the terrazzo itself rather than a wax coating.
- Wet grinding helps reduce airborne dust and supports a cleaner work process.
- Metal Dot Diamond Infused Pads remove old wear, stains, and surface damage.
- Diamond Infused Resins refine the floor from a honed finish to a high polish.
- The shine is created through mechanical polishing, which reduces dependence on waxes.
- The finished floor is easier to clean and maintain after restoration.
Chip and Crack Repair for a Seamless Restoration
Terrazzo restoration often involves more than polishing. Many older floors in Paradise Heights have chips, cracks, tack strip holes, carpet nail damage, or areas where previous flooring left marks behind. Coast To Coast Terrazzo Restoration provides precise chip and crack repair as part of the restoration process when needed.
We carefully repair damaged areas so they blend as closely as possible with the surrounding terrazzo. Matching terrazzo requires attention to color, aggregate, and finish. Once the repairs are ground and polished with the rest of the floor, the surface has a more complete and consistent appearance.
These repairs can make a significant difference in the final result, especially in rooms where old carpet, tile, or adhesive covered the original floor for years. Restoring these areas helps the floor feel intentional again, rather than patched or unfinished.
Terrazzo Sealing and Protection Options
After grinding and polishing, the right protection depends on how the space is used, the desired finish, and the amount of daily wear the floor receives. Coast To Coast Terrazzo Restoration offers several sealing and strengthening options for terrazzo floors in Paradise Heights.
- Oil-based sealer for deeper penetration and a long-lasting sheen.
- Water-based acrylic sealer for lighter daily wear protection.
- Sealer crystallizer for maximum shine and an airport-grade finish.
- Densifying treatment that hardens and strengthens floors, lasting 10+ years in high-traffic areas.
An oil-based sealer can be a good choice when deeper penetration and a lasting sheen are desired. A water-based acrylic sealer offers lighter protection for spaces with moderate daily use. For floors where maximum shine is the goal, a sealer crystallizer can create a highly reflective, airport-grade finish.
For high-traffic areas, densifying treatment adds long-term strength by hardening the terrazzo surface. This treatment can last 10+ years in demanding environments and is often recommended when durability and reduced maintenance are priorities.
A Natural Shine Without the Strip-and-Rewax Cycle
Traditional waxing can make terrazzo look shiny for a short time, but wax tends to yellow, scuff, collect dirt, and require periodic stripping and reapplication. Mechanical polishing creates shine by refining the terrazzo itself. This gives the floor a cleaner appearance and reduces the ongoing labor associated with wax maintenance.
Once restored, a properly polished terrazzo floor can be maintained with simple sweeping, dust mopping, and recommended neutral cleaners. This makes day-to-day upkeep easier for homeowners, property managers, and anyone responsible for keeping a space clean.
